## 2.8.0 — Changed Defaults

The Wrenlock Kotlin SDK now matches the Swift SDK on retry and timeout behavior. Previously Kotlin retried twice with no backoff; both SDKs now use jittered exponential backoff. Review diffs against the Swift client, not the old Kotlin defaults. Apps pinning old values are unaffected. The new shared defaults are as follows.

config for tagep-yajef:
ulawyn:
  log_level: error
  metrics_host: metrics.ulawyn.lumiclabs.internal
  pin: 0564
  pool_size: 32

Leadership Review Briefing — Retail Pilot

Board summary: Averline Goods has agreed to pilot our Sparrowcart checkout units across six of their Westmere-area stores for ninety days. Setup costs are within approved limits. Success metrics: transaction speed, shrinkage, staff adoption. Early installs complete; first data arrives in three weeks. If metrics hold, Averline will consider a chain-wide rollout. Risks: integration bugs, staffing turnover. The confidential note on business plans appears below.

confidential, bawig-bajeg: Headcount on the Oliix team goes from 5 to 80 by the end of January. Gross margin on Oliix came in at 10 percent against a plan of 20 percent.

Heads up, new folks! This alert fires whenever the revamped password reset flow on Project Lumenhart throws more than five failures in a ten-minute window. Usually it's the token expiry job acting up, not an actual outage, so don't panic. Check recent deploys first, then ping the Flowsmith channel. Full triage steps live on the internal runbook page here:

wiki page, tahaf-tajog: https://jira.ordindyn.corp/pipeline